Description

Mount Willingdon is located in the wild eastern section of Banff National Park, the last expansive area of true wilderness within the park. This mountain is more about scenic views, wild animal encounters, or hopefully only viewing, and long approaches then quality climbing or classic mountaineering. Having just said that, the North-East Face of the Willingdon Massif presents an extensive glacier and a beautiful snow/ice route, likely unrepeated since the original 1977 ascent.

Description

This mountain provides the backdrop for every picture taken of the Las Vegas Strip. It is easy to get to for all tourists and locals, and seems like a natural FKT for Vegas. The view from the top (Lake Mead to the East and Vegas to the West) is outstanding.  There is a Strava segments for the ascent, the descent, and round trip.
